Jennifer Aniston
Jennifer Aniston is best known for her role as Rachel Green on the hit TV show Friends, but her career spans decades, with notable performances in both television and film.
Despite her success, Aniston has faced public scrutiny over her decision not to have children. She has openly discussed her struggles with fertility and IVF treatments, ultimately embracing her life without kids. Aniston emphasizes that her choice does not define her worth or success, advocating for women to live authentically and without societal pressure.
Dolly Parton
Dolly Parton is a legendary country singer, songwriter, and actress. She rose to fame with hits like 'Jolene' and '9 to 5,' significantly influencing country music.
Parton and her husband, Carl Dean, never had children due to health issues, including a partial hysterectomy. Embracing her role as a mentor and philanthropist, she focuses on her career and charitable work, notably the Imagination Library, which promotes children's literacy.

Keanu Reeves
Keanu Reeves is a Canadian actor known for his roles in 'The Matrix' and 'John Wick' series. His career has been marked by critical and commercial success.
In the '90s, Reeves tragically lost both his daughter and wife in quick succession, and the actor has now resigned himself to the fact that he will not start a family. In 2017, Reeves stated, "I'm too... it's too late. It's over. I'm 52. I'm not going to have any kids."
